Which statement accurately describes the major site of fat digestion?

Explanation:
Most fat digestion happens in the small intestine, with the duodenum being the primary site where triglycerides are broken down by pancreatic lipase. Fats are emulsified by bile salts, which increases the surface area for pancreatic lipase to act. This enzyme, with the help of colipase, converts triglycerides into free fatty acids and monoglycerides, which then form micelles for absorption. While there is some lipase activity earlier in the mouth and stomach, the bulk of digestion occurs in the duodenum, making that statement the best description of the major site of fat digestion. The liver does not provide all enzymes for stomach fat digestion, and the colon is not the main site. Pancreatic lipase is the major enzyme in the small intestine, but it does not digest all fats in every context because other lipases and gastric lipase contribute as well.
